Responsibilities

  • Provide excellent inpatient behavioral health nursing services including but not limited to therapeutic interventions; mental status exams; crisis assessment, intervention and management; medication administration and monitoring; and coordination of client’s medication with pharmacies and pharmaceutical companies.
  • Provide Internal and external care coordination services to effectively manage the physical and behavioral health care needs of clients and ensure seamless integration of complex services.
  • Insure accurate, timely documentation to meet regulatory standards and/or contractual requirements.
  • Demonstrate understanding of admission and discharge medical necessity criteria and ability to make appropriate admission and discharge decisions.
  • Actively participate and contribute within a team-based model of care to ensure integration of services and promote improved client outcomes.
  • Improve client satisfaction and health outcomes through direct client assessment and intervention, medication management and collaborative care delivery.
  • Effectively respond to phone inquiries and referrals. For referrals, obtain complete, accurate admission and history information from the client, his/her family, and the referring agency or therapist within the required time frame.
  • Communicate effectively to establish supportive therapeutic relationships with clients to evaluate, screen, educate and provide therapeutic interventions and care coordination to best meet client treatment goals.
  • Accurately carry out the physician’s orders and order client’s medications as needed.
  • Assess and review incoming documentation for admission based on medical necessity criteria.
  • Coordinate with Psychiatrist, Program Manager, and/or Clinical Supervisor as needed to ensure that admissions are appropriate based on risk level, medical and behavioral health status, client need and financial/insurance status.
  • Ensure ongoing safety in the milieu through ongoing, vigilant monitoring of clients and facility environment. This includes performing client safety interventions as needed, including de-escalation, use of the seclusion room, and use of physical or mechanical restraints following the ATU policies and procedures.
  • Follow infection control policies and procedures and serve as the team’s consultant regarding standard precautions.
  • Monitor all laboratory work and consult with the medical provider (MP) when lab results are abnormal. Recommend related medication or other lab work if not ordered by the MP.
  • Screen clients for health issues related to the use of psychotropic medications and other medical concerns; provide education around managing medications and chronic illnesses; make referrals for ongoing care as indicated.
  • Skillfully observe, assess and accurately document client’s mental status and progress and provide appropriate interventions and communication to other involved team members.
